An NPD practitioner is preparing to implement a major workflow change. Which action best reflects their role in leading change?

Explanation:
Leading change means actively uncovering what could hinder adoption so you can plan around it. Identifying barriers allows you to tailor training, adjust workflows, secure necessary resources, and set a realistic timeline that fits how staff actually work. This proactive analysis helps you design a rollout that is practical, acceptable to frontline teams, and more likely to stick over time. Other approaches miss the hands-on implementation focus: supporting every change without question lacks critical assessment; teaching staff about historical change theories, while useful, doesn’t directly drive the current workflow rollout; and letting change happen without involvement removes the guidance and accountability needed for safe, effective change.
